The American Society for Nutrition (ASN) is a key leader in advancing nutrition research, advocating to strengthen nutrition research support at the NIH and other federal agencies. ASN regularly partners with the many federal agencies that touch nutrition science. In case you haven’t already heard, check out NIH Director Dr. Francis Collins’ opening remarks for NUTRITION 2020 LIVE ONLINE, where he highlights the Strategic Plan for NIH Nutrition Research which ASN commented on and which many ASN members were involved in throughout the development process.
